Transaction 587714913168f327edbb6e913aabb8b1d57e9790b47dbaf71eead109bd6c84ab
1 Input
1 Output
-
587714913168f327edbb6e913aabb8b1d57e9790b47dbaf71eead109bd6c84ab:0
- value
- 1386562
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4cc1a851f0c4c446961e437b3c7cf29fd34cd90
- address
- bc1q6nxp4pglp3xyg6tpusmm8370987nfnvsdp354w